Put the right equipment to work sooner

Equipment finance can help a business acquire an income-producing asset while preserving cash for wages, stock and daily operations.

The product might be a loan secured by the equipment, a hire-purchase style arrangement, a lease or broader business finance. Ownership, deposits, residual payments, early payout rules and tax treatment can differ, so compare the complete structure rather than the repayment alone.

Lenders may consider the asset's age, condition, purchase price, supplier and expected working life alongside your business financial position. A quote or invoice usually helps define what is being funded.

Match the term to the asset

A repayment term that extends well beyond the equipment's useful life can leave the business paying for an asset it can no longer rely on. Factor in maintenance, insurance, registration, downtime and replacement timing when checking affordability.

Before you sign for the asset

What can a business equipment loan fund?

Depending on the lender and product, equipment finance can fund vehicles, machinery, tools, computers, medical equipment, hospitality equipment and other income-producing business assets.

Is the equipment used as security?

Some equipment finance products use the financed asset as security. Other business loan structures may also be available. Security, guarantees and ownership arrangements depend on the lender and contract.

Can I finance used equipment?

Some lenders finance eligible used equipment, subject to its age, condition, value, seller and useful life. The lender may request a quote, invoice or valuation.

Are equipment loan repayments tax deductible?

Tax treatment depends on the finance structure, asset and business circumstances. Seek advice from a registered tax adviser or accountant before relying on a deduction.
